Abstract
Es wird ein Verfahren zur Herstellung eines Koaxialkabels beschrieben, bei welchem auf einen kontinuierlich zugeführten Innenleiter eine dielektrische Schicht aufextrudiert wird, um diesen so gebildeten isolierten Leiter ein längseinlaufendes Metallband zum Schlitzrohr geformt und an seinen Längskanten verschweißt wird, und das geschweißte Rohr auf die Oberfläche der dielektrischen Schicht heruntergezogen wird. Hierbei wird ein zumindest auf einer seiner Oberflächen mit einer Kunststoffschicht versehenes Metallband verwendet, und das Verschweißen der Längskanten wird durch Laserschweißen vorgenommen. A method for producing a coaxial cable is described, in which a dielectric layer is extruded onto a continuously supplied inner conductor, around which insulated conductor thus formed a longitudinally running metal strip is formed into a slot tube and welded on its longitudinal edges, and the welded tube onto the surface of the dielectric layer is pulled down. In this case, a metal strip provided with a plastic layer on at least one of its surfaces is used, and the longitudinal edges are welded by laser welding.
